Output 66b335ab84a8058da503a534698f509e66d2a88250e5a5083cebe1b56c954b37:1

value
19583767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ada2133d59fa04d7fe29505a818ed89494d5767a OP_EQUAL
address
3HX6yui9dt7zKRwjwe7ZJoxQWU9iXTaYD9
transaction
66b335ab84a8058da503a534698f509e66d2a88250e5a5083cebe1b56c954b37
spent
true